Notice of Plagiarism and Copyright Infringement California Notice of Plagiarism and Copyright Infringement is a legal document used in the state of California to address instances where the intellectual property rights of an individual or organization have been violated. It serves as a formal notice to inform the alleged infringed about the violation, demanding immediate cessation of the infringing activities. There are two main types of California Notice of Plagiarism and Copyright Infringement: 1. Notice of Plagiarism: This refers to situations in which someone has copied original written or creative work without permission or proper attribution. Plagiarism is an act of claiming someone else's work as one's own, which infringes upon the author's copyright. 2. Notice of Copyright Infringement: This type applies to cases where any form of creative work, such as music, art, films, software, or written content, is being used without obtaining the necessary permissions from the copyright owner. Copyright infringement involves unauthorized reproduction, distribution, display, or adaptation of copyrighted material. When serving a California Notice of Plagiarism and Copyright Infringement, it is crucial to include specific details such as: 1. Identifying the copyrighted work: Clearly state the title, author, or any unique identifier of the original work that has been infringed upon. 2. Describing the infringement: Provide a detailed explanation of how the infringing party has used, reproduced, distributed, or performed the copyrighted material without permission or proper acknowledgment. Include dates, locations, and any evidence supporting the claim. 3. Contact information: Include valid contact details for the copyright owner or their designated representative, such as name, address, phone number, and email address. 4. Demanding compliance: Explicitly state the actions expected from the infringing party, such as permanently ceasing the infringing activities, removing the content, and providing compensation for damages caused. 5. Legal consequences: Mention the potential legal consequences of failing to comply with the notice, emphasizing that the copyright owner is entitled to seek monetary damages, injunctive relief, and attorney's fees if the infringement continues. It is crucial to consult a qualified attorney specializing in intellectual property law to draft or review a California Notice of Plagiarism and Copyright Infringement, as specific legal requirements must be met to ensure its effectiveness.
